¿Ponen en peligro los ordenadores cuánticos nuestra seguridad?

 Seguro que has escuchado que losordenadores cuánticos van a inutilizar el cifrado actual, poniendo en jaque nuestra seguridad en internet. Pues bien, para saber si esto es cierto, lo primero será conocer cómo se cifra un mensaje. Concretamente, vamos a centrarnos en el cifrado asimétrico.

Para comprender el cifrado asimétrico, antes es necesario conocer que son los números coprimos. Al hablar de números coprimos, hablamos de parejas de números cuyo máximo común divisor es 1. Por ejemplo 8 y 6 no son coprimos (su MCD es 2), pero 8 y 9 sí (su MCD es 1).

Una vez conocemos qué son los números coprimos, podemos entender el proceso llevado a cabo para el cifrado asimétrico:

  1. Elegimos 2 números primos grandes p y q
  2. Obtenemos su producto, al que llamaremos n. n=pq
  3. Obtenemos z, siendo z=(p-1)(q-1)
  4. Buscamos un número primo menor que z y que no sea coprimo con z. A este número lo llamaremos e. De esta manera z no es divisible entre e.
  5. Buscaremos un número d tal que su múltiplo con e divida a z dando uno como resto. O lo que es lo mismo, d*e-1 es divisible entre z
Con estos números conseguimos las parejas de claves del cifrado asimétrico: (e,n), serí la clave pública y (d,n) la clave privada.

Este cifrado tiene un problema importante, ya que si encontramos el número z podemos deducir las claves reventando este sistema (sistema RSA). Para encontrar el número z es necesario saber antes los números primos q y p, que se obtienen al factorizar el número n. Con la tecnología actual es practicamnete imposible factorizar n, pero aquí es donde entran los ordenadores cuánticos, que si podrían. 

Existe un algoritmo, algoritmo de Shor, que es capaz de encontrar los factores de un número primo y que pueden ser aprovechados por los ordenadores cuánticos. Por lo tanto sí, los ordenaodres cuánticos podrían poner en peligro las comunicaciones y la seguridad en internet. Pero para eso ya hay varios protocolos de seguridad postcuántica en los que se están trabajando para mantener la seguridad.

Comentarios

Entradas populares de este blog

¿Cómo se fabrica un qubit? (Pt.1)

¿Cómo funciona un ordenador cuántico?

¿Willow confirma la existencia de universos paralelos?